Keeping machines in good condition saves a lot of money in the long run. This leads to higher consumption of Fuel and other materials, and slows down all fieldwork. All machines degrade at least 5 times faster than the base rate while doing actual fieldwork.Īllowing your machines to degrade results in slower, weaker vehicles and tools. Vehicles and non-fieldwork Implements degrade twice as fast when driving on a field. Idle machines do not degrade at all, no matter how long they remain untouched. Machines can be repaired at any time from the Garage menu, but cost much less to repair at the Store or Workshop.Īll machines in the vanilla version of FS19 suffer damage at a rate of 100% damage per 16 hours (about 0.00173% per second), but only while moving or working. Repairing a machine back to perfect condition costs a fraction of the machine's original purchase cost (up to 1%), depending on how damaged the machine is. Vehicles lose Horsepower as their condition degrades, whereas Implements lose Maximum Work Speed.
